2) TEACHING--Participation of Children He is happy that the children are being attracted. They are the pillars of the future, and should be trained and encouraged in every way, to learn the details of the teachings, and how to teach others. For the true source of existence is the diffusing of Glad Tidings. (104) TEACHING--Teaching Relatives (104) TEACHING--Teaching Relatives He would not advise you to in any way force the teachings on your husband, but rather through prayer, love and example attract his heart to what he will be forced to see has not only made you a happier person but a better wife and mother than ever before. It is often most difficult to teach those nearest to us, but the Guardian will earnestly pray that your husband and children will join you in serving this wonderful Cause.
